Subject: Fix daemon notification for short warning periods

When the warning period for notifications is less than 60 seconds
(DAEMON_SLEEP_TIME), the daemon may be at sleep when the appointment
comes up. If that happens, no notification is launched. In stead, the
daemon should launch the notification early.

Addresses GitHub issue #204, part 2.
